The table below is a standard list of gp practice metrics that are complied annually for practices in England. You can use this list to see how Emmer Green Surgery is doing in areas that may be important to you. |
Health Metric | Detail | Indicator |
---|---|---|
Cervical Screening Ages 25 to 49 | 1,293 individuals have been screened out of a possible 1,860 eligible people.A total of 69.5% of possible patients have been screened which is below the 80% requirement. The GP practice needs to sceen another 195 people to hit the required 80% screening target. | 1,293 |
Cervical Screening Ages 50 to 64 | 777 individuals have been screened out of a possible 1,036 eligible people.A total of 75% of possible patients have been screened which is below the 80% requirement. The GP practice needs to sceen another 52 people to hit the required 80% screening target. | 777 |
Overall number of GP appointments | 5,142 Number of appointments in Aug 2023 from a practice list size of 11,655 patients | 5,142 |
Face to face appointments | 3,179 Face to Face appointments in Aug 2023 which is 61.8% of the total number of appointments. | 3,179 |
Home Visits | 0 Home Visits in Aug 2023 which is 0% of the total number of appointments. | 0 |
Telephone appointments | 1,866 Telephone appointments in Aug 2023 which is 36.3% of the total number of appointments. | 1,866 |
Unknown appointments | 97 Unknown appointments in Aug 2023 which is 1.9% of the total number of appointments. | 97 |
Video call appointments | 0 Video call appointments in Aug 2023 which is 0% of the total number of appointments. | 0 |
